COMMERCIAL.
Goorfio Thomas reports produce prices as follows: —Flour, of undoubted quality, is firm nt £11; second brands, £lO 103; oats, principally Marlborough production, command 29 3d to 2s Gd for lair to prime samples; fowls wheat, of good whole grain, is rather scarce, and may be quoted at 3s; fowl's barley, market full and slow of sale from 2s Gd to 2s 9d; maiza (New Zealand), 3s Gd to 3s 8d; bran, £4 to £4 ss; pollard, £5, in good demand for winter supplies; oaton chaff, £4 10s, beans 3s 9d; Brown River and Derwent potatoes are now being offered in large parcels at 60s, exclusive of sacks; carrots, 42s Gd; Canterbury cheese rules from 4£a to sd; stocks are still large and no improvement in price is anticipated at present; hams and bacon, 9d ali round; salt butter is easier, and maybe bought at B|d and 9d; fresh, 9|d to lOd. . Thore have been'(no arrivals of assorted ship-
menta of fruit, peaohes ; apples, and poara being the only description, and these have sold fairly well, apples from 8s to Cs; pears, 6a to 16s; and peaches, 5a to Bs. Eggs in domand at Is lOd to Is lid j fowls, 3s 9d; docks. 4s par pair; SHAKE EEPOBT.
